Google Budget Sheets, a comprehensive curated collection of the best Google Sheets budget templates, officially launches today, offering users a streamlined way to take control of their finances without starting from scratch. The free service provides carefully selected budget templates for a wide range of financial needs, including personal budgeting, business finance management, student expenses, and specialised approaches like the 50/30/20 method or zero-based budgeting.

“Our mission is to make budgeting accessible to everyone by connecting users with high-quality, free templates that can be customised to fit specific needs,” said a spokesperson for Google Budget Sheets. “Whether you’re a student, professional, business owner, or just looking to get your finances in order, we’ve got templates that will work for you.”

Key features of Google Budget Sheets Include

  • Categorised Templates: Users can filter templates by type (monthly, annual, personal, business, student) to quickly find what best meets their needs.
  • Featured Selections: Highly-rated templates with the best combination of features, ease of use, and flexibility are highlighted for new users.
  • Comprehensive Guide: A step-by-step guide helps users choose the right budget template based on their goals, spreadsheet comfort level, preferred time period, and visual preferences.
  • FAQ Section: Detailed answers to common questions about template usage and customisation.

Among the featured templates is the Foundation Template from Tiller, which automatically connects to bank accounts; Google‘s Annual Business Budget, perfect for small business owners; and the popular 50/30/20 Budget Snapshot which helps users balance needs, wants, and savings. The service also includes specialised options such as weekly budget templates for variable income earners, visually-oriented calendar views, and templates specifically designed for university students.

Google Budget Sheets launched at a time when financial planning has become increasingly important for households and businesses navigating economic uncertainty. All templates are compatible with Google Sheets, allowing users to access and update their budgets across devices. The service is available immediately at no cost, with all templates ready to be saved to users’ Google Drive accounts for immediate use.
